Service Brakes, forward Collision Avoidance
07/17/2025
I WAS STOPPED AT A RED LIGHT, IT TURNED GREEN AND I PROCEEDED TO DRIVE FORWARD THROUGH THE INTERSECTION WHEN ALL OF A SUDDEN THE AUTOMATIC BRAKING SYSTEM ENGAGED BRINING THE CAR TO AN IMMEDIATE STOP IN THE MIDDLE OF THE INTERSECTION. MY PASSENGER AND I WERE THRUST FORWARD INTO THE STEERING WHEEL AND DASHBOARD RESPECTIVELY. THE CAR BEHIND ME HIT ME. BOTH CARS SUSTAINED DAMAGE. THERE WAS NOTHING IN FRONT OF ME THAT SHOULD HAVE CAUSED THIS SAFETY SYSTEM TO ENGAGE.I BELEIVE THEY CALL THIS PHANTOM BRAKING. BECAUSE I HAD JUST STARTED UP FROM THE LIGHT, MY SPEED WAS SLOW AND WE SUSTAINED NO INJURIES. HOWEVER IF THAT HAPPENED ON THE FREEWAY I TRAVEL QUITE FREQUENTLY, I WOULD HAVE BEEN KILLED. I AM SO STRESSED ABOUT DRIVING THIS CAR, I ASKED CADILLAC TO DISENGAGE IT. GM AND CADILLAC BOTH DID INSPECTIONS AND CADILLAC SAID THERE IS NOTHING WRONG WITH THE BRAKING SYSTEM. Forward Collision Avoidance
08/26/2025
On [XXX] my car auto brake unexpected early afternoon on [XXX] . SPEED WAS APPROXIMATELY 53 mph. A Mack dump truck almost rear ended me. On [XXX] the same thing happened in Philipsburg NJ on [XXX] . CAR WAS BROUGHT TO Faulkner Cadillac in Bethel, Pa. In both cases, there were no cars or objects in my path. About 2 months ago the same thing happened at low speed in Watchung, NJ. IT HAS HAPPENED 3 other times in reverse. Faukner reprogrammed front view camera for the [XXX] incident. It has failed and has nearly caused be to be in 2 very serious accidents. Various other XT4 Cadillac owners have reported similar incidents. I asked my Cadillac dealer to refer this to GM. I’m afraid to drive the vehicle. Power Train, service Brakes, engine
06/08/2025
While driving on the highway, my vehicle suddenly engaged the brakes without any obstacle ahead, creating a dangerous and frightening situation. Immediately after this incident, the Check Engine and Transmission System warnings also appeared. This vehicle is still new, and it is completely unacceptable to experience failures in major systems like AEB, engine, and transmission. I have since learned about TSB #24-NA-053, which describes false AEB activations in XT4 models. My concern is that my vehicle may be affected. This car was purchased without notification of this issue from the dealership regarding the xt4 and obviously it was also not resolved upon my purchase of the car. Power Train, vehicle Speed Control, engine
05/01/2025
While driving the vehicle on 01 May 2025, the car rapidly decelerated from over 60MPH to under 30 MPH in an instant. The car would not go over 30MPH. The power steering was off, the safety restraint was off, service transmission warning was on, engine light was on,low fuel indicator was on (I had over a half tank of gas), and service stabilitrak was on. The car had to be towed to the dealership. This is the second time this has occurred within the last 45 days. I just purchased the car in the middle of March. This is extremely unsafe as if I was on a highway I would be injured, someone else would be injured or death. I filed a complaint on 20 March 2025 (Complaint No: 11649676).

Service Brakes, back Over Prevention, forward Collision Avoidance
04/21/2025
While backing up I had situations where the automatic brakes would engage although there was no obstruction behind the car. To stop this from happening, I had to turn this feature off. I brought the car in for service (Ed Morse Cadillac in Delray Beach, Florida) and was given a Cadillac Service Bulletin that acknowledged this was a problem with 2023-2025 cadillacs and there was no fix for this problem. They suggest that I do what I had done- turn it off. I feel this is not an adequate response. This is a very important safety feature that helps to insure that motorists will not hit objects while going in reverse, and more importantly will not hit a person or child, possibly causing severe injuries. Cadillac should find a way to fix this issue before someone is killed because of this.
